Re: Old School Graphics/Sounds
all graphics can be edited, and are client-side only. if you wanted to you could change out horses to beetles and ride those around (only visible to you), for example..
I've not seen any odd looking daemons in the UOSA's client installer since it was made from an original T2A cd patched up to 5.0.8.3. I don't know at which point they changed artwork but depending what version you installed or if it was the ML client, etc, your artwork could be different (and could be changed back, but would be a lot of work as opposed to just using the UOSA client installer).
